Hi there! I use My Fathers World Kindergarten curriculum and supplement with Explode the Code for spelling/language building/penmenship. I supplement Singapore Math which I LOVE. My preschooler is almost halfway through the K book and my Kindergartener started the 1st grade book after Christmas. We are homeschooling our kindergartener this year and really enjoying it. We are using Horizons for math and phonics. She also goes to a homeschool PE class one day a week. She gets to do Spanish,karate, and Chinese at the pe class. We are almost done with her K math and are waiting on her 1st grade math book to get here. We will also be homeschooling our 3 yr old. I will be starting the Pre-k curriculum in a few weeks.
